Nebraska Christian and Cedar Catholic squared off in some playoff action on Friday, but Nebraska Christian had to settle for second. They lost 65-42 to the Cedar Catholic Trojans. The Eagles' loss signaled the end of their six-game winning streak.
Anisten Wortmann had an outrageously good game for Cedar Catholic as she shot 56% from the field to rack up 16 points along with five rebounds and five steals. The game was Wortmann's third in a row with at least 16 points. Another player making a difference was Katelyn Arens, who posted nine points and six boards.
Nebraska Christian's defeat dropped their record down to 19-7. As for Cedar Catholic, the win was the third in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 15-11.
As of now, neither Nebraska Christian nor Cedar Catholic have any future games scheduled.
